Team,

The Spoolhaven printer-spooler microservice was cut over from the monolith queue last night. Jobs now flow through the new intake worker; the old poller is stopped but not yet removed, so expect its code to linger one more release. Retry semantics changed: failed jobs park for review rather than requeueing indefinitely, which eliminated the duplicate-printout complaints from the Marlow site. Monitoring dashboards were updated this morning. For anyone debugging later, the service came up with the following configuration:

deployment values, yadug-bawif:
[framir]
team = pelox
access_code = ac_a38ab2
owner = tamion.julael
host = framir.tolvaqlabs.test
port = 11211
peer = tammir.zemvargrid.local
salt = 2215ef03
pin = 1541

## Building Access: Weekend Lift Maintenance

Welcome to Bramfield Court. Lifts are serviced by Ostley Vertical on the first weekend of each month, usually Saturday 06:00–14:00. During maintenance, use the east stairwell or the single lift left in service (signage will tell you which). New starters should note that the stairwell doors lock automatically at weekends, so you cannot re-enter a floor without a pass. If you are working a maintenance weekend, unlock stairwell doors with the weekend access code below.

staff pass of haweg-bafop = bdg-G-69

Migration step 4: Enabling idempotency keys for payment retries in Ledgefox. Before flipping the flag, confirm the retry worker pool is drained and that the dedupe store has been provisioned in both regions. Keys are derived from the merchant reference plus attempt window, so any mismatch in window length between services will cause silent duplicates. Once drained, apply the following configuration to the payments gateway and restart it.

deployment values, kajep-kageg:
[praix]
host = praix.paliqcorp.corp
user = praix_svc
database = praix_prod

### Ledgerbird Payments — Integration Test Stability

Support staff triaging flaky integration failures in the Ledgerbird payments service should first check whether the sandbox settlement simulator was mid-restart, as roughly half of reported flakes trace to that. Genuine failures leave a correlation record in the reconciliation log, which distinguishes them from timing noise. To rerun a failed suite against the pinned simulator snapshot, call the test-orchestrator endpoint using the key below.

gateway credential: kto23_LX9A4ys6i4nzHtpOLNLodKK